Output bbfbf26eb8127b5666a46e2000ed80ca44caf1aa27a8029eedbbcfc2e0400c85:1

value
1068660
script pubkey
OP_0 OP_PUSHBYTES_20 b83efbab1ade921eac9f65faecd30b6b3a1481e8
address
bc1qhql0h2c6m6fpatylvhawe5ctdvapfq0gdaysyk
transaction
bbfbf26eb8127b5666a46e2000ed80ca44caf1aa27a8029eedbbcfc2e0400c85
confirmations
68884
spent
true